Перейти к содержанию
    

сжатие звука на arm7

Люди добрые помоги чем можете, сами мы не местные :biggrin:

С армами ни когда не работал, поэтому отнеситесь снисходительно к возможной лаже в вопросе.

 

Поставил один "сильно умный" заказжкик задачу: в реальном времени сжимать по одному каналу звук 8бит * 8кГц (лучше больше) и передовать по RS485 9600бод и "разжимать" по 4-ем, и все одновременно, без щелчков и задержек. И самое главное что бы за 3 копейки. На все запцацки не более 20$, то есть на проц примерно 10$.

 

Тоесть требуеться: 1encoder(вход 8бит*8кГц, выход 9600 бот с учетом старт/стоп) & 4coder в одном кристале и одновременно что бы работало, управлялось и тестировалось. :maniac:

 

 

Вопрос знатокам: как на ваше мнение возможно ли это сделать на недорогом арме (например AT91SAM7S128)????? Может посоветуете какой нибудь готовый программный кодек (ссылочку плз.)

 

Если не затруднительно подскажите на какого производителя лучше ориентироваться (по цене вроде атмел лучше)

 

И слышал что для армов есть большое кол-во ресурсов с готовыми решениями и алгоритмами (ссылочки плз.)

 

Заранее всем благодарен

Поделиться сообщением


Ссылка на сообщение
Поделиться на другие сайты

..в реальном времени сжимать по одному каналу звук 8бит * 8кГц (лучше больше) и передовать по RS485 9600бод и "разжимать" по 4-ем, и все одновременно, без щелчков и задержек.
В соседней ветке уже обсуждали эту тему: Сжатие звука.

Поделиться сообщением


Ссылка на сообщение
Поделиться на другие сайты

Поставил один "сильно умный" заказжкик задачу: в реальном времени сжимать по одному каналу звук 8бит * 8кГц (лучше больше) и передовать по RS485 9600бод и "разжимать" по 4-ем, и все одновременно, без щелчков и задержек.
т.е. 9600бод на 5 каналов?? действительно "умный" заказчик.. это уже сразу НЕ_ARM

 

И самое главное что бы за 3 копейки. На все запцацки не более 20$, то есть на проц примерно 10$.
TMS320VC5501 - 5уе. Производительности - хоть с десяток вокодеров тянуть туда/сюда.

 

И слышал что для армов есть большое кол-во ресурсов с готовыми решениями и алгоритмами (ссылочки плз.)
а чем они такие особые?.. Они используют специальный "Си"?))

Поделиться сообщением


Ссылка на сообщение
Поделиться на другие сайты

ARM7TDMI на пределе с большой оптимизацией.

ARM9 легко, лучший вариант это STR91x, в бюджет как раз укладываетесь.

Поделиться сообщением


Ссылка на сообщение
Поделиться на другие сайты

Присоединяйтесь к обсуждению

Вы можете написать сейчас и зарегистрироваться позже. Если у вас есть аккаунт, авторизуйтесь, чтобы опубликовать от имени своего аккаунта.

Гость
К сожалению, ваш контент содержит запрещённые слова. Пожалуйста, отредактируйте контент, чтобы удалить выделенные ниже слова.
Ответить в этой теме...

×   Вставлено с форматированием.   Вставить как обычный текст

  Разрешено использовать не более 75 эмодзи.

×   Ваша ссылка была автоматически встроена.   Отображать как обычную ссылку

×   Ваш предыдущий контент был восстановлен.   Очистить редактор

×   Вы не можете вставлять изображения напрямую. Загружайте или вставляйте изображения по ссылке.

×
×
  • Создать...